In order to provide agricultural market intelligence, insight, and analysis of interest to exporters of U.S. agriculture, USDA Indonesia generates 21 scheduled public Global Agricultural Information Network (GAIN) reports annually. 

Besides the scheduled GAIN reports, USDA Indonesia may also generates time-critical public voluntary GAIN reports regarding important policy or market changes that is not covered by the scheduled GAIN reports.

Indonesia Clarifies Prior Notice and Export Timing Requirements with Key Barriers Remaining

ID2025-0020 – Published on May 14, 2025

Upon request from Post, the Indonesian Quarantine Agency clarified in writing that the export timing and Prior Notice requirements take effect on June 4, 2025, via regulation 14/2024 and provided additional clarifications on the regulation. Notably, the cutoff date refers to the shipment’s departure date as stated on the Bill of Lading. In addition, the Indonesian Quarantine Agency clarified the export timing requirement is different than previously reported, without resolving the fundamental concerns. This report provides additional guidance to help industry prepare for implementation of the regulation while FAS Jakarta seeks an extension and long-term solution. In addition, it provides confirmation of previously provided guidance regarding Prior Notice submissions for genetically engineered products.
